Greetings Cornerstone Church Family!

These are challenging time because of COVID-19!  However, our faith and confidence in God has not been shaken; we are continuing to trust and depend on Him! 

We plan to continue to hold our Sunday Worship Service at 10am. However, we plan to use wisdom.  We are wiping down with bleach solution the door- knobs and places for where we easily touch.  Until further notice we will suspend the Hospitality time and Children Church School.  Also, we encourage you not to shake hands and embrace as is our custom. 

Any members especially the most at-risk, including, but not limited to, senior citizens and persons with health conditions should feel free not to come out. 

Cornerstone will continue to stream our services through www.thecornerstonechurch.net.  Let others know that we are streaming.  Also, please continue to give online.  Please be mindful of the guidance from the CDC:

  • If you become sick, stay home and call your doctor
  • Wash your hands often with soap and water for at least 20 seconds especially after you have been in a public place, or after blowing your nose, coughing, or sneezing.
  • If soap and water are not readily available, use a hand sanitizer that contains at least 60% alcohol.  Cover all surfaces of your hand and rub them together until they feel dry.
  • Avoid touching your eyes, nose, and mouth with unwashed hands.
  • Avoid close contact with people who are sick.

From a spiritual perspective we are under God’s grace and care.  “No weapon form against us shall prosper.” Psalms 91 is the scripture for these times: vs.1 “Those who live in the shelter of the Most High will find rest in the shadow of the Almighty… vs. 5. Do not be afraid of the terrors of the night nor the arrow that flies in the day. Vs.6 Do not dread the disease that stalks in darkness, nor the disaster that strikes at midday. Vs7 Though a thousand fall at your side, though ten thousand are dying around you these evils will not touch you. (NLT)”

Be encourage family we are praying for each of you, and please pray for me and the entire church family!
 
Pastor Maxwell H. Ware
